How to fix/replace the back shelf holes on sedan?

15K views 21 replies 12 participants last post by  vleong2332 
#1 ·
My back shelf ventilation (or whatever their purpose is ) holes are actually holes now:



Can you guys advice me how to fix this. I was able to remove the shelf itself pretty easy but I don't know how to replace these foam inserts.
 
See less See more
1
#6 ·
I'm pretty sure there is a tsb for this issue, so Ford should take care of it if you are still within warranty. Otherwise there is a new part number for that piece you can order which should no longer fall apart. That new part is what they are putting into current MY.
